Abstract
The real implementation of DC-DC boost converters controllers is slightly difficult due to their non minimum phase behavior and the non zero output voltage error. Integral Sliding Mode Controllers (ISMC)s have proved to be able to deal with this kind of converters and to eliminate the chattering phenomenon. In order to cancel the output voltage error, we apply in this paper, an ISMC to a detailed modelling of boost converter (by considering the associated parasites). Numerical and experimental comparative studies with the ideal case and the classical SMC verify the effectiveness and the robustness of this controller.
